Internship Eligibility

Shodor provides many opportunities that enable students to participate in part time internships during the summer as well as throughout the school year. The Mentor Center is located at our office in Durham. Internship applicants should be current majors or demonstrate proficiency in one or more areas of science; this includes chemistry, physics, biology, education, mathematics, environmental sciences, biomedical engineering, medicine, computer science, information technologies and other sciences. Some internships may require programming ability (C, Java, Javascript, PHP, MySQL, etc.) or graphics and web design skills, while others may require experience and interest in scientific subject matter. Prior experience is preferred, but training for qualified internship candidates is available.
